WebNov 29, 2024 · Getting labor going can help to reduce the risk of interventions such as a C-section. Taking castor oil has been found to help induce labor and ripen the cervix. 1 It also often has unpleasant side effects, particularly the possibility of dehydration, stomach cramps, and diarrhea. WebWhat is the effect of induction of labor on cesarean delivery? The use of induction of labor has increased in the United States concurrently with the increase in the cesarean delivery rate, from 9.5% of births in 1990 to 23.1% of births in 2008 76 77. WebPitocin® is a synthetic version of oxytocin, and doctors use this IV medication for labor induction. This drug helps imitate natural labor and birth by causing the uterus to contract. WebSep 13, 2024 · Common side effects of Prepidil may include: contractions that are more frequent; slow heartbeats in the baby; nausea, stomach pain; feeling of warmth in the vaginal area; back pain; or. fever.
